How it works

  1. Initial enquiry: You get in touch with our team in Bratislava to discuss your school's needs, group size, and preferred dates.
  2. Custom concept design: We work together to decide on a theme—whether it is a school value, a specific curriculum topic, or a free-expression project.
  3. Safety and theory intro: On the day, we start with a fun intro about graffiti culture and a vital safety briefing regarding the equipment.
  4. Technical practice: Students learn 'can control,' experimenting with different nozzles (caps) to create lines, dots, and fades on practice surfaces.
  5. Sketching the mural: Under our guidance, students help sketch the outlines of the main project onto the wall or large wooden panels.
  6. Filling and blending: This is where the colour happens! Students work together to fill in the piece, learning how to blend colours and create gradients.
  7. Outlining and highlights: Our professional artists help students add the final sharp outlines and 'shines' that make the artwork pop.
  8. Final review and photos: We finish with a group discussion about the work and take plenty of photos of the students with their masterpiece.

Practical details

Our school workshops are designed to be as easy as possible for teachers to organise. We provide all the necessary professional equipment, including premium low-pressure spray paint (easier for beginners to control), high-grade respiratory masks, gloves, and protective suits. Sessions typically last between 2 and 3 hours, but we can adapt to your school's bell schedule. We prioritise safety above all else, ensuring all students are briefed on proper technique and equipment use. We can host the workshop at your school premises (if a suitable outdoor space is available) or at one of our dedicated legal graffiti spots in Bratislava.
